The history of beverage fortification dates back to the early 1930s, when dairy manufacturers began adding vitamin D to milk to combat rickets. Milk fortification is a vital process that significantly boosts the nutritional value of both liquid and dry milk products by integrating essential vitamins and minerals.

Liquid Milk Fortification

Liquid milk fortification enhances nutritional value by adding essential vitamins and minerals. The process involves mixing a small aliquot of cold milk with an oily vitamin premix, followed by homogenisation to ensure uniform distribution. Finally, this fortified blend is incorporated into the bulk milk, improving its health benefits.
